JO ELLEN WORMSBECHER

Funeral services for Jo Ellen Wormsbecher, 87, of Avon are Wednesday, January 28 at 10:30 a.m., at the Danzig Baptist Church, rural Avon. Burial is in the Danzig Baptist Cemetery. Visitation will be at the church on Tuesday from 5-7 p.m. Peters Funeral Chapel in Avon is in charge of arrangements.

LEGISLATIVE UPDATE

Week two picked up with more committee hearings and bills being heard. There are currently254billsand19resolutionsfiled.We have a lot of work to do. During my 1st term in the legislature, we passed a law banning hostile foreign ownership of ag land in South Dakota,whichIproudlysupported.Thisyear weexpandedonthatconcepttoincludeelectric infrastructure with HB 1049. HB 1049 was vetted in Commerce and Energy Committee, where I serve as the Vice Chair. HB 1049 received a yes vote from all members present in the full chamber. Also, in Commerce and Energy a resolution and a bill pertaining to theuseofcashtransactionswereheard.Isupported the resolution encouraging the use of cashtransactions,butIcouldnotsupportabill forcing small businesses to accept cash. We haveenoughregulationsonsmallbusinesses, and I will not tell you what form of payment you should accept. In State Affairs we heard HB 1102 an act to reschedule the annual report filing date for a limited liability company and a limited liability partnership. Currently LLCs and LLPs report on the anniversary of their filing date. This bill changes the annual reporting to a set schedule where all would take place in the same time frame. If you operate 10 different LLCs or LLPs reporting can be forgotten or late, I believe this bill will streamline that process and save on late fees.

AVON LADY PIRATES ROLL PAST K/WL, 53–20

TheAvonLadyPirateswere on the road Monday night, January19,takingonKimball/ White Lake and turned in a strong performance to earn a 53–20 victory. Rilyn Thury led all scorers with 24 points and was dominant on both ends of the floor, adding 11 rebounds and 6 steals. Breanna Hentopulleddown8rebounds, while Brielle Voigt dished out 4 assists.
